Output 869ed0635d1d4e603142b2b685ffd5a2fdd0a0cb3a9f340b5e78915066711c2e:0

value
1733450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177df24cf7a62b65e931e5848f48be7afa86e0df OP_EQUAL
address
33qELsUuALfCbskr4C7MYW9zSGUqmKLy1Z
transaction
869ed0635d1d4e603142b2b685ffd5a2fdd0a0cb3a9f340b5e78915066711c2e
confirmations
423313
spent
true